export const displayModifierKey = (key: keyof Omit<KeyCombination, 'keyCode'>) => {
const mac = isMac;
switch (key) {
case 'ctrl': {
return mac ? '⌃' : 'Ctrl';
}
case 'alt': {
return mac ? '⌥' : 'Alt';
}
case 'shift': {
return mac ? '⇧' : 'Shift';
}
case 'meta': {
if (mac) {
return '⌘';
}
if (isWindows) {
// Note: Although this unicode character for the Windows doesn't exist, the Unicode character U+229E ⊞ SQUARED PLUS is very commonly used for this purpose. For example, Wikipedia uses it as a simulation of the windows logo. Though, Windows itself uses `Windows` or `Win`, so we'll go with `Win` here.
// see: https://en.wikipedia.org/wiki/Windows_key
return 'Win';
}
// Note: To avoid using a Microsoft trademark, much Linux documentation refers to the key as "Super". This can confuse some users who still consider it a "Windows key". In KDE Plasma documentation it is called the Meta key even though the X11 "Super" shift bit is used.
// see: https://en.wikipedia.org/wiki/Super_key_(keyboard_button)
return 'Super';
}
default: {
throw new Error(key + 'unrecognized key');
}
}
};
/**
* Construct the display string of a key combination based on platform.
* For example, the display of alt in Windows or Linux would be "Alt";
* while in Mac would be "⌥".
* @param mustUsePlus if true will join the characters with " + " for all platforms;
* otherwise if the platform is Mac, the characters will be next to each other.
* @returns the constructed string, if keyCode is null and the characters are joined with " + ",
* it will have a dangling "+" as the last character, e.g., "Alt + Ctrl +".
*/
export function constructKeyCombinationDisplay(keyComb: KeyCombination, mustUsePlus: boolean) {
const { keyCode } = keyComb;
const chars: string[] = [];
const addModifierKeys = (keys: (keyof Omit<KeyCombination, 'keyCode'>)[]) => {
keys.forEach(key => {
if (keyComb[key]) {
chars.push(displayModifierKey(key));
}
});
};
if (isMac) {
// Note: on Mac the canonical order is Control, Option (i.e. Alt), Shift, Command (i.e. Meta)
// see: https://developer.apple.com/design/human-interface-guidelines/macos/user-interaction/keyboard
addModifierKeys(['ctrl', 'alt', 'shift', 'meta']);
} else {
// Note: on Windows the observed oreder (as in, if you just try to make a shortcut with all modifiers) is Windows (i.e. Super/Meta), Ctrl, Alt, Shift.
// No such standard really exists, but at least on Ubuntu it follows the Windows ordering.
addModifierKeys(['meta', 'ctrl', 'alt', 'shift']);
}
if (keyCode != null && !isModifierKeyCode(keyCode)) {
chars.push(getChar(keyCode));
}
let joint = joinHotKeys(mustUsePlus, chars);
if (mustUsePlus && isModifierKeyCode(keyCode)) {
joint += ' +';
}
return joint;
}
